How they compare

Thailand currently reports -91.99 Mt CO2e against -110.71 Mt CO2e in Namibia, a difference of 18.72 Mt CO2e.

Across all 24 years both countries report, Thailand has been ahead every year.

Namibia ranks 173rd and Thailand ranks 170th of 183 countries.

Thailand has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Namibia Thailand Difference Ahead
2000s -100.3 Mt CO2e -57.25 Mt CO2e 43.05 Mt CO2e Thailand
2010s -107.63 Mt CO2e -84.25 Mt CO2e 23.38 Mt CO2e Thailand
2020s -109.4 Mt CO2e -91.99 Mt CO2e 17.41 Mt CO2e Thailand

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
